Navigating the Official BTS YouTube Channels
The primary destination for any fan of BTS on YouTube is undoubtedly the official HYBE LABELS channel. This is where all the major music video releases land, often accompanied by premiere events that bring millions of fans together in real-time. Think of the iconic visuals for "Dynamite," "Butter," "Permission to Dance," or the more recent releases – they all debut here. Beyond the MVs, HYBE LABELS also hosts other artist content, so it's essential to know where to find the specific BTS uploads.
However, the heart and soul of BTS's YouTube presence lies within the BANGTAN TV channel. This is the group's own content powerhouse, delivering a consistent stream of engaging videos that go far beyond just music promotion. Here's what you can expect:
- BANGTAN BOMB: Short, often hilarious, and incredibly endearing clips capturing moments from music video shoots, award show preparations, and everyday life. These are a fan-favorite for their unscripted charm.
- Dance Practices: Witness the incredible synchronization and individual talent of BTS members as they perform choreography in practice rooms. These are often filmed from multiple angles, offering a true appreciation for their skill.
- BTS Episodes: Longer-form content that delves deeper into specific events, tours, or behind-the-scenes aspects of their careers. These can range from travel vlogs to in-depth looks at their creative process.
- Vlives and Special Broadcasts: While many Vlives were hosted on the V LIVE platform, significant moments and replays are often uploaded or linked to from BANGTAN TV, allowing fans to catch up on live interactions and special announcements.
- Logos and Branding: Look out for the distinctive BTS logo and the channel's overall aesthetic, which clearly signals official content. This is crucial to differentiate from fan-made content, although fan content also plays a vital role in the ecosystem.
When searching for "bts youtube channel," these are the primary locations you should be directing your attention. They are the source of truth and the most comprehensive repositories of official BTS material.

The Impact and Evolution of BTS on YouTube
BTS's relationship with YouTube is symbiotic. The platform has been instrumental in their global rise, providing a direct pipeline to international audiences that traditional media channels couldn't always offer. Their meticulously crafted music videos, often packed with Easter eggs and narrative threads, are perfectly suited for the visual-first nature of YouTube. The ability to release content on demand, engage with fans through premieres and live chats, and build a massive subscriber base on channels like BANGTAN TV has been a cornerstone of their strategy.
Conversely, BTS has also profoundly impacted YouTube. They have consistently broken viewership records, pushed the boundaries of what's possible with music video promotion, and demonstrated the immense power of a dedicated online fandom. The scale of their online presence has likely influenced how other artists and labels approach their YouTube strategies, emphasizing high-quality visuals, consistent engagement, and community building.
Their influence extends to the very culture of YouTube. The phenomenon of "YouTube premieres," where millions tune in simultaneously to watch a new music video, was amplified by BTS. Similarly, the practice of collaborative fan projects, like mass streaming parties or coordinated hashtag campaigns to boost visibility, often center around BTS content on the platform.
Furthermore, the evolution of their content on YouTube mirrors their artistic growth. From their early, grittier concepts to the polished, global anthems of today, their YouTube output tells a story of their journey, their evolving sound, and their expanding message. Whether it's the raw energy of a debut-era dance practice or the sophisticated storytelling in a recent MV, fans can trace this development directly on YouTube.

Q6: What is the difference between HYBE LABELS and BANGTAN TV?
A6: HYBE LABELS is the main distribution channel for official music videos and promotional content from all HYBE artists. BANGTAN TV is specifically dedicated to content created by and for BTS, offering a more personal and behind-the-scenes look at the group.
